Lagoonal grass bed, of Thallassia testudinum, encrusted with
epibionts including coralline algae, serpulids, and foraminifera. The
grass protects the bottom sediment from erosion and resuspension, leading
to poor sorting and fine-grained size. Note echinoderm Tripneustes
in center of photo, camouflaged with grass blades.
